Hair testing is now regarded as a potent method for identifying drug and alcohol consumption. Hair retains a long-term record of substances by embedding biomarkers within the growing strands. When obtained near the scalp, hair offers an approximate 3-month detection period for these substances. It's easy to collect hair, fairly resistant to tampering, and straightforward to transport.
A 1.5-inch segment of roughly 200 hair strands, akin to the diameter of a #2 pencil, taken near the scalp, yields 100mg of hair, the optimal amount for both screening and confirmation. For EtG, additional tests, and/or panels exceeding 10, 150mg of hair is preferred. We advise weighing the hair on a jeweler’s scale. Should scalp hair be absent, an equivalent quantity of body hair may be used. When mentioning head hair, we refer solely to scalp hair. Body hair encompasses all other hair types (facial, axillary, etc.).
Process Overview
The laboratory processing of drug test results involves four primary steps: Accessioning, Screening, Extraction, and Confirmation.
Accessioning refers to the initial introduction of a sample into a lab's system. This step ensures the sample was correctly sealed and transported, assigns a unique LAN (Laboratory Accessioning Number), and completes any necessary data tasks not handled by an electronic chain of custody system.
Screening is a rapid preliminary test for drugs of abuse. While cost-effective for ruling out substance use in most samples, a positive screening result must be verified for legal acceptability. All samples testing positive in Screening require subsequent confirmation.
For samples with a positive result in the Screening phase, additional hair is extracted from the original sample for further processing in Extraction. Here, drugs are separated from hair at much lower concentrations than other tests (e.g., urine or oral fluid), emphasizing the complexity of hair-based drug testing.
To confirm any positive screening outcomes, methods such as GC/MS, GC/MS/MS, or LC/MS/MS are used. Before final confirmation, presumptive positive samples are washed as necessary. The entire laboratory workflow, from Accessioning to Confirmation, is conducted under the CAP (College of American Pathologists) Hair guidelines and in compliance with ISO / IEC 17025 standards.

Note: Although sometimes called "hair follicle tests", the analysis focuses on the hair strand rather than the follicle beneath the scalp.
